这里介绍常见的编程范式,包括:面向过程编程、面向对象编程、函数式编程、反应式编程(响应式编程)。另外有个分类是命令式(Imperative)和声明式(Declarative),命令式编程的主要思想是关注计算机执行的步骤,即一步一步告诉计算机先做什么再做什么。而声明式编程是以数据结构的形式来表达程序执行的逻辑。它的主要思想是告诉计算机应该做什么,但不指定具体要怎么做。函数式编程是属于声明式编程,其他
转载
2023-10-10 07:45:19
72阅读
# 深入理解“Java第一范式”
作为一名刚入行的开发者,学习和理解Java的基础概念是非常重要的。今天,我们将讨论“Java第一范式”。这个范式强调数据与行为的结合,确保数据的完整性和一致性。以下是实现这一范式的基本流程,以及我们在每一步需要执行的具体代码。
## 一、实现“Java第一范式”的流程
为了帮助你更好地理解,为了我们达到目标,下面是实现Java第一范式的基本步骤:
| 步骤
范式 范式(Paradigm)是符合某一种级别的关系模式的集合。关系数据库中的关系必须满足一定的要求,满足不同程度要求的为不同范式。 目前关系数据库有六种范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、Boyce-Codd范式(BCNF)、第四范式(4NF)和第五范式(5NF)。
转载
2019-04-28 15:31:00
817阅读
2评论
数据库中设计一个好的标准化范式能大大减少数据冗余,增强数据的易操作性。范式的演变:第一范式:表中没有重复数据身所有属性全...
原创
2022-12-19 14:12:30
268阅读
1.第一范式(确保每列保持原子性) 第一范式是最基本的范式。如果数据库表中的所有字段值都是不可分解的原子值,就说明该数据库表满足了第一范式。 第一范式的合理遵循需要根据系统的实际需求来定。比如某些数据库系统中需要用到“地址”这个属性,本来直接将“地址”属性设计成一个数据库表的字段就行。但是如果系统经
转载
2020-09-01 14:18:00
2168阅读
2评论
第一范式的关系规定关系第一范式规定关系的每一个属性必须是一个不可分的数据项
转载
2022-08-26 08:54:58
167阅读
范式:英文名称是 Normal Form,它是英国人 E.F.Codd(关系数据库的老祖宗)在上个世纪70年代提出关系数据库模型后总结出来的,范式是关系数据库理论的基础,也是我们在设计数据...
转载
2014-07-04 19:22:00
546阅读
2评论
数据库最低标准应当是第三范式第一范式概念:实例:————————————————————————————————————————第二范式概念:实例:修改实例:————————————————————————————————————————第三范式概念:实例:实例修改:...
原创
2021-09-02 17:50:08
10000+阅读
强调属性的原子性约束,要求属性具有原子性,不可再分解。举例:学生表(学号、姓名、年龄、性别、地址)。因为地址可以细分为国家、省份、城市、市区、街道,那么该模式就没有达到第一范式。第一范式存在问题:冗余度大、会引起修改操作的不一致性、数据插入异常、数据删除异常。
原创
2022-10-22 23:52:18
158阅读
文章目录什么是”范式(NF)” 1. 第一范式(1NF) 2. 第二范式(2NF) 2.1 函数依赖 2.1.1完全函数依赖 2.1.2 部分函数依赖 2.2 码
原创
2021-07-05 11:23:35
2944阅读
1.背景介绍数据库是现代信息系统中不可或缺的组成部分,它负责存储和管理数据,以及对数据进行查询和修改。数据库的设计和实现是一项复
原创
2024-01-08 13:34:50
412阅读
第一范式:不可分割的列第二范式:创建的列必须和这个表信息符合第三范式:在第二范式的基础上创建外键,主键与列之间存在直接关系第一范式(1NF)定义:如果关系模式R的每个关系r的属性都是不可分的数据项,那么就称R是第一范式的模式。简单的说,强调的是列的原子性,即列不能够再分成其他几列1NF是关系模式应具备的最起码的条件,如果数据库设计不能满足第一范式,就不称为关系型数据库。关系数据库设计研究的关系规范
转载
精选
2014-06-29 21:02:47
2205阅读
数据库逻辑设计前面我们讲了第二范式,我们知道还有第三范式,那么第三范式的特点到底是什么呢?下面我们来一起看定 a, b, c, d 的值,那么 { a } 就是码,{ c, d } 就
原创
2022-06-29 17:50:00
1620阅读
我们在数据库表设计时,经常说,某某表要遵循第三范式。下面通过实例介绍第一,第二,第三范式 第一范式所谓第一范式,就是数据表的列不可再分。看下面数据表,对于选课列明显是可以再分的,所以它是违反第一范式的。 学号 姓名 选课 10001 张三
转载
2023-05-19 16:52:51
90阅读
第一题 result = []x = x.strip().split("<")for res in x: res = res.split(">")[0] result.append(res) 第二题 result = []x = x.strip().split("<")for res in x: r
转载
2017-07-25 18:57:00
71阅读
2评论
第一范式(1NF):字段具有原子性,不可再分。所有关系型数据库系统都满足第一范式)数据库表中的字段都是单一属性的,不可再分。例如,姓名字段,其中的姓和名必须作为一个整体,无法区分哪部分是姓,哪部分是名,如果要区分出姓和名,必须设计成两个独立的字段。第二范式(2NF):第二范式(2NF)是在第一范式(1NF)的基础上建立起来的,即满足第二范式(2NF)必须先满足第一范式(1NF)。要求数据库表中的每
转载
2023-09-05 20:52:16
63阅读
1 第一范式(1NF) 在任何一个关系数据库中,第一范式(1NF)是对关系模式的基本要求,不满足第一范式(1NF)的数据库就不是关系数据库。 所谓第一范式(1NF)是指数据库表的每一列都是不可分割的基本数据项,同一列中不能有多个值,即实体中的某个属性不能有多个值或者不能有重
转载
2024-02-02 11:01:15
52阅读
这篇文章来自于我的一个回答,内容进行了少量调整,并补充了几个习题。为简单起见,并不非常严谨地区分 “关系” 和 “数据表” 的概念。
转载
2022-07-20 09:14:26
97阅读
三大类设计模式:创建型模式,共五种:工厂方法模式、抽象工厂模式、单例模式、建造者模式、原型模式。结构型模式,共七种:适配器模式、装饰器模式、代理模式、外观模式、桥接模式、组合模式、享元模式。行为型模式,共十一种:策略模式、模板方法模式、观察者模式、迭代子模式、责任链模式、命令模式、备忘录模式、状态模式、访问者模式、中介者模式、解释器模式。除持之外,还有两类:并发型模式和线程池模式。 六项
转载
2024-07-01 19:59:06
29阅读
关系化之--第一范式化。
原创
2011-05-19 03:45:09
877阅读
点赞